Household Food Security of Rice Farmers Based on Food Expenditure and Energy Consumption in Singaran Pati Sub-District, Bengkulu City Ifebri, Rihan; Wibowo, Hariz Eko; Fauzi, Ariffatchur; Nolasary, Mega Putri

Abstract

This study was conducted in the Singaran Pati Sub-district of Bengkulu City to analyze food expenditure shares, energy consumption, and household food security levels among rice-farming households. A descriptive-analytical method was employed, with research sites selected purposively and samples determined proportionally, resulting in 63 respondents from Dusun Besar and 34 from Panorama. Both primary and secondary data were utilized. Food expenditure share was calculated based on the ratio of food to total household expenditure, while energy consumption was assessed using a one-sample t-test. Food security status was measured by cross-classifying food expenditure share and energy consumption. The results show that the food expenditure share reached 80.98%, indicating a high category, while energy consumption was 97.38%, categorized as sufficient. Overall, most rice-farming households were classified as food-insecure.

STRATEGI PENETAPAN HARGA DENGAN VARIASI HARGA DAN LABA USAHA TOKO BUAH DI KOTA BENGKULU Sari, Clarita Tasya Mutiya; Reflis, Reflis; Wibowo, Hariz Eko; Supriyadi, Supriyadi

Abstract

This study aims to determine fruit prices and profit margins based on pricing strategies, examine price variations, and determine whether there are significant differences among pricing strategies in fruit shops in Bengkulu City. This study employed a quantitative survey of fruit stores in Bengkulu City, identified via Google Maps, using descriptive, profitability, price variability (CV), and statistical analyses. The results show that 61 types of fruit are sold, with imported fruit commanding higher prices than local fruit. Value-based pricing strategies yield the highest profit margins and sales revenue, although statistical tests indicate no significant differences among pricing strategies. The high CV value indicates that price variation is becoming increasingly heterogeneous. However, an increasing variety of fruits and high price variation do not necessarily correlate with increased revenue for the fruit store business. This study underscores the importance of value-based pricing strategies in enhancing profitability and customer loyalty.
PENGARUH FAKTOR LOKASI TERHADAP LABA USAHA TOKO BUAH DI KOTA BENGKULU Prasiska, Luki; Utama, Satria Putra; Wibowo, Hariz Eko; Fauzi, Emlan

Abstract

 Bengkulu City, as the capital of Bengkulu Province, has experienced rapid growth in the trade sector, in line with the increase in population reaching 397,321 people in 2024. This condition makes fruit shop businesses have great potential to develop, although their success is highly dependent on selecting a strategic location, considering that fruits are perishable goods. This study aims to map the distribution of fruit shop locations, analyze the influence of location factors on business profits, and formulate appropriate location selection strategies. The research was conducted from November to December 2025 using a census method of 35 fruit shops, of which 25 agreed to be interviewed. A descriptive quantitative approach was applied through GIS analysis and multiple linear regression. The results show that the distribution of fruit shops is uneven and concentrated in several districts, and that only the number of visitors significantly affects profits, indicating that location strategies must be adjusted to market characteristics.
